A company manufactures computers on a highly automated assembly line it's costing system uses two cost categories Direct materials and conversion costs each product must pass through the assembly line and Test department Direct materials are added at the beginning of the production process conversion costs are allocated evenly throughout the production the company uses weighted average costing data for the assembly line for June work in process beginning inventory 370 units Direct materials 100% complete conversion costs 60% complete unit started during June 20xx 970 units work in process ending inventory 250 units Direct materials 100% complete conversion costs 80% complete cost for June 20 xx work in process beginning inventory Direct materials 90,000 conversion cost 170,000 Direct material costs added during June 602,500 conversion cost added during June 401,000 what are the equivalent units for direct materials conversion costs respectively for June?

1248, 1120

1340, 1290

1220, 1220

1340,1050
